Rapides Parish Sheriff's Office seeks public's help to ID Honda theft suspects
According to detectives, a 2019 green Honda Pioneer was reported stolen on Oct. 25, 2025, between noon and 11 p.m. The vehicle features a light bar attached to the front bumper and rear glass, along with a homemade fabricated rear bumper.
Investigators said the stolen side-by-side was later spotted on Tuesday, Oct. 28, in Grant Parish, being driven by two white males.
Anyone with information about the theft or the suspects is urged to contact Detective John T. DeVille of the Criminal Investigation Division – Kolin Substation at 318-484-7350, the Main Office at 318-473-6700, or Crime Stoppers at 318-443-7867.
Anonymous tips may be eligible for a cash reward.
